Job Description Job Description Empowered for Excellence
Behavioral Health is a nonprofit agency that offers specialized
counseling in the field of substance abuse, mental health, and
behavioral treatment services. Our mission is to provide
comprehensive and compassionate, integrated mental health and
substance abuse services which are client-focused . Our commitment
is to deliver the highest quality of treatment through faith-based
principles, education advocacy, and service excellence. General
Summary: Plans, directs and manages all clinical related programs
and services. Plans, organizes and implements effective operational
policies and procedures. Coordinates operational quality assurance
plans; monitors operational compliance with external reviewers
(e.g. Medicare, CARF, OHMAS, etc.). Provides leadership, management
and vision necessary to ensure that the agency has the proper
operational controls, administrative and reporting procedures, and
people systems in place to effectively grow the organization and to
ensure financial strength and operating efficiency. Investigates
all unusual problems involving client care and/or program
management. Serves as consultant and liaison to subordinates and
other staff. Develops, writes and updates operations and procedure
manuals and conducts site visits to all operational areas to review
client care services. The position accomplishes this through a
respectful, constructive, energetic style, guided by the objectives
of the agency. Performs related work activities as required and
assigned.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Provides clinical
management to all areas of clinical service delivery in the agency;
establishes goals and objectives aimed at program growth and
efficacy of treatment in assigned service/program areas; identifies
and oversee the implementation of evidenced based practices and
outcomes measurement in assigned service/program areas; develops,
in conjunction with Management Team, proposed objectives, staffing
patterns and budgets for clinical services; implements year-round
programming that addresses client needs and meets all applicable
standards; provides managerial oversight to all team members;
ensures all direct service staff are provided clinical supervision
to all team members assigned to the program; recommends a system of
programming for achieving budget goals and assuring quality of care
by adhering to relevant best practices and State mandated
requirements; works with staff to identify program development and
growth opportunities; ensures that treatment decisions are made in
the best interest of the client; provides and documents individual
and group supervision; ensures agency compliance with Medicaid and
other applicable standards to achieve organizational efficiencies
and supervise professional and/or paraprofessional staff;
responsible for the measurement and effectiveness of all processes
internal and external; provides timely, accurate and complete
reports on the operating conditions of the clinical services;
collaborates with the management team to develop and implement
plans for the operational infrastructure of systems, processes, and
personnel designed to accommodate growth objectives of the agency;
conducts annual and introductory evaluations of all direct
reporting employees and contractors (as applicable); manages
hiring, evaluation, and terminations in consult with Human
Resources; performs other duties as deemed as necessary and
appropriate by supervisor. Minimum Qualifications: Master’s degree
from an accredited college or university in social work or
counseling coupled with a minimum of seven (7) years demonstrated
experience in clinical management and licensure as a LISW, LPCC,
additional certification in substance abuse counseling is
preferred. LISW-S or LPCC-S preferred. Must have a valid vehicle
operator’s license and complete CPR training within 90 days of
hire. Knowledge, Skills and Abilities: Demonstrated knowledge of
social work and case management practices and protocols;
demonstrated knowledge of the concept of team building and
constructive leadership; demonstrated knowledge of substance abuse
and mental health programming; excellent computer skills, including
proficiency in Microsoft Office; must have excellent oral and
written communication skills; must be able to problem solve and to
be able to operate independently in the absence of supervisor; must
be detailed and deadline oriented; ability to meet changing demands
and exhibit a high degree of professionalism; demonstrated ability
to meet deadlines; ability to effectively interact with all levels
of staff, clients and other agencies and the public; demonstrated
ability to provide effective leadership and/or assistance to
coworkers and clients through the integrated care process; ability
to demonstrate consistent professionalism; ability to Abide by the
agencies and/or professional code of ethics. Excellent written and
oral communication skills. Experience in Microsoft WORD and Excel.
